The Health Graph provides detailed insights into an animal’s behavioral trends and health status. It combines data on eating, ruminating, and inactivity with calendar events and health issues to help you assess animal well-being over time. You can also customize the graph to focus on the data that matters most to you.
What the Health Graph Shows
The health graph consist of two sections:
- Line graph: Displays trends over time for eating, ruminating, and inactivity, along with health issues and calendar events
- Bar graph: Shows a 48-hour snapshot of detailed behavior in colored blocks
Line Graph
Bar Graph
Shows a 48-hour detailed bar of the behavior in colored blocks
Colors indicate type of behavior
Width represents duration
Urgent health issues are marked by a red line above the bar
Where to Find the Health Graph
You can open the health graph from the Worklist dashboard, Cow app, or any Custom worklist.
From the Worklist dashboard:
- Select the Health checks or a Custom worklist.
- In the Active tab, select a row or the arrow icon to open the graph.
From the Cow app:
- Select List of animals.
- Select the animal number.
- In the left panel, select Health.
How to Use the Health Graph
Navigate the line graph:
Select a time range (7 to 60 days)
Compare the health score with behavior trends over time
For shorter time periods, more detailed data is shown
- View 48 hour details in the bar graph.
- The colors indicate behavior type.
- The width represents behavior duration.
- Only urgent health issues are shown in the bar graph. These are indicated with a red horizontal line above the bar graph.
- Hover over health issues for more information
Examples of Health Graphs
- Chronically sick cows:
- Line Graph: Long periods of low eating and ruminating, high inactivity.
- Bar Graph: Many grey blocks, indicating extended inactivity

- Recovering after a health issue
- Line Graph: Inactivity decreases, eating and ruminating increase.
- Bar Graph: Shift from grey blocks to more blue blocks (eating and ruminating).
